Good to see that there's lots to play going into the week. Only us and Kent have qualified, and no-one has secured the two automatic SF spots.
1st vs 4th and 3rd vs 2nd in the South group, which most likely should sort out the order of the top three. I imagine the game Sky pick for Wednesday will be one of those two. In theory, any of Gloucs, Surrey and Middlesex could still muscle their way into 3rd, should Essex and Somerset both slip up.
2nd vs 1st and 3rd vs 4th in the North group. Thursday's live match will then almost certainly be Warks v Worcs, which is itself effectively a QF - in that the winner takes the automatic North group SF spot. The loser will be in great danger of also missing out on a home play-off, given the fact that the next two then play each other. Indeed, the loser of Warks v Worcs could miss out altogether, if Yorks were to win the Roses match on Tuesday, and then follow it up with victory over Northants. That would almost certainly be enough for Yorks to jump straight up to 2nd and secure a home QF, thus downgrading Notts v Derby from a qualification shoot-out with a home play-off as the prize (if Yorks lose the Roses match), to a qualification shoot-out with an away play-off as the prize.
